How much does it cost to rent a home in University?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| University 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,386 | $950 | $3,350 |
| University 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,568 | $600 | $2,700 |
| University 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,052 | $550 | $3,800 |
| University 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,000 | $2,000 | $2,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about University
What type of rentals are currently available in University?
There are currently 427 Apartments for Rent in University, FL with pricing that ranges from $305 to $10,805. There are also 168 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in University ranging from $550 to $3,800.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in University?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in University ranges from $550 to $3,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,478.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in University?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in University range from $549 to $3,150,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$600 to $2,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$550 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$399.
